Punjab provided 1.33 lakh Agri Machinery to farmers on subsidised prices to dispose off stubble: Dhaliwal

Nawanshahr, October 28, 2022 (Yes Punjab News)
Punjab Agriculture Minister Kuldeep Singh Dhaliwal said here today that the Chief Minister Bhagwant Mann led Punjab government is making all possible efforts to dispose of stubble in the state without burning. Under it, as many as 1.33 lakh agricultural implements have been made available in the state on subsidy to the farmers.

He was addressing gathering at Wajidpur village here in today after giving a demo of Smart Seeder (a wheat planting sowing without setting fire to stubble) by himself driving tractor. He said that this machine is made with the dual technology of Super Seeder and Happy Seeder in Punjab and it will prove a boon for straw disposal. He said that smart seeder machine, capable of working with small tractor, will also be given on subsidy.

The price of Smart Seeder machine, a mixture of Happy Seeder and Super Seeder machines, is around Rs 2,30,000. This machine is becoming the choice of farmers due to its small tractor operation and low diesel consumption. This machine sows one acre in an hour at the rate of 5.0-6.0 liters of diesel per hour.

Minister for Agriculture and Farmers Welfare, Rural Development and Panchayat and NRI Affairs Dhaliwal said that the performance of this machine was demonstrated today in the presence of administrative , departmental officials as well as Doaba Kisan Union President Kuldeep Singh Wajidpur and other farmers so that Farmers can be made an important part of the government’s awareness campaign against stubble burning.

Addressing the farmers, Minister Dhaliwal said that we need to replace the traditional crop rotation of paddy and wheat and switch to alternative crops like sugarcane, maize and pulses to save air from getting polluted and water from depleting in Punjab. He said that Punjab has sacrificed its natural resources to fill the country’s food bowls.

He said that now the time has come that we should also save the water of our state. He said that maximum area should be brought under sugarcane. He said that the government has paid all the dues of sugarcane and has also increased the SAP as per the wishes of the farmers.

He appealed to the farmers to give full support to the efforts of the government to save the environment and water table of Punjab from further depletion so that the economy of Punjab state based on agriculture can also be sustained.
